summaryrefslogtreecommitdiff
path: root/jstests/parallel
diff options
context:
space:
mode:
authorScott Hernandez <scotthernandez@gmail.com>2014-03-25 11:09:37 -0400
committerScott Hernandez <scotthernandez@gmail.com>2014-03-25 13:46:52 -0400
commit835a7cc8ea3c564d34876d20b90b37750d7e30c5 (patch)
tree69a51e618b6ce1955becff374d0d5a06e611c85d /jstests/parallel
parentce5a47a3b506cbd0154c60144deb5cd0e6a3aea9 (diff)
downloadmongo-835a7cc8ea3c564d34876d20b90b37750d7e30c5.tar.gz
SERVER-13297: convert parallel suite to use jsCore tests
Diffstat (limited to 'jstests/parallel')
-rw-r--r--jstests/parallel/allops.js1
-rw-r--r--jstests/parallel/basic.js1
-rw-r--r--jstests/parallel/basicPlus.js1
-rw-r--r--jstests/parallel/checkMultiThread.js1
-rw-r--r--jstests/parallel/del.js1
-rw-r--r--jstests/parallel/insert.js1
-rw-r--r--jstests/parallel/manyclients.js1
-rw-r--r--jstests/parallel/repl.js1
-rw-r--r--jstests/parallel/shellfork.js3
9 files changed, 11 insertions, 0 deletions
diff --git a/jstests/parallel/allops.js b/jstests/parallel/allops.js
index 7eb0cb2e386..7f94fb5fa23 100644
--- a/jstests/parallel/allops.js
+++ b/jstests/parallel/allops.js
@@ -1,4 +1,5 @@
// test all operations in parallel
+load('jstests/libs/parallelTester.js')
f = db.jstests_parallel_allops;
f.drop();
diff --git a/jstests/parallel/basic.js b/jstests/parallel/basic.js
index bcb4d654ea0..c7d44142042 100644
--- a/jstests/parallel/basic.js
+++ b/jstests/parallel/basic.js
@@ -1,4 +1,5 @@
// perform basic js tests in parallel
+load('jstests/libs/parallelTester.js')
Random.setRandomSeed();
diff --git a/jstests/parallel/basicPlus.js b/jstests/parallel/basicPlus.js
index 4d65d255486..c3d432ef600 100644
--- a/jstests/parallel/basicPlus.js
+++ b/jstests/parallel/basicPlus.js
@@ -1,4 +1,5 @@
// perform basic js tests in parallel & some other tasks as well
+load('jstests/libs/parallelTester.js')
var c = db.jstests_parallel_basicPlus;
c.drop();
diff --git a/jstests/parallel/checkMultiThread.js b/jstests/parallel/checkMultiThread.js
index d43b1ae5066..9210378ed9c 100644
--- a/jstests/parallel/checkMultiThread.js
+++ b/jstests/parallel/checkMultiThread.js
@@ -1,3 +1,4 @@
+load('jstests/libs/parallelTester.js')
var start = new Date();
print("start: " + start);
diff --git a/jstests/parallel/del.js b/jstests/parallel/del.js
index fd4a3f13fe1..c2994924097 100644
--- a/jstests/parallel/del.js
+++ b/jstests/parallel/del.js
@@ -1,3 +1,4 @@
+load('jstests/libs/parallelTester.js')
N = 1000;
HOST = db.getMongo().host
diff --git a/jstests/parallel/insert.js b/jstests/parallel/insert.js
index fc1c750795a..86fa0258d39 100644
--- a/jstests/parallel/insert.js
+++ b/jstests/parallel/insert.js
@@ -1,4 +1,5 @@
// perform inserts in parallel from several clients
+load('jstests/libs/parallelTester.js')
f = db.jstests_parallel_insert;
f.drop();
diff --git a/jstests/parallel/manyclients.js b/jstests/parallel/manyclients.js
index daf13b5eefe..ce5172301a4 100644
--- a/jstests/parallel/manyclients.js
+++ b/jstests/parallel/manyclients.js
@@ -1,4 +1,5 @@
// perform inserts in parallel from a large number of clients
+load('jstests/libs/parallelTester.js')
f = db.jstests_parallel_manyclients;
f.drop();
diff --git a/jstests/parallel/repl.js b/jstests/parallel/repl.js
index 8cc8dcdbb9f..240002656e8 100644
--- a/jstests/parallel/repl.js
+++ b/jstests/parallel/repl.js
@@ -1,4 +1,5 @@
// test basic operations in parallel, with replication
+load('jstests/libs/parallelTester.js')
baseName = "parallel_repl"
diff --git a/jstests/parallel/shellfork.js b/jstests/parallel/shellfork.js
index 20a1d3df786..d89e6c5d547 100644
--- a/jstests/parallel/shellfork.js
+++ b/jstests/parallel/shellfork.js
@@ -1,3 +1,5 @@
+load('jstests/libs/parallelTester.js')
+
a = fork( function( a, b ) { return a / b; }, 10, 2 );
a.start();
b = fork( function( a, b, c ) { return a + b + c; }, 18, " is a ", "multiple of 3" );
@@ -13,6 +15,7 @@ assert.eq( "18 is a multiple of 3", b.returnData() );
assert.eq( "paisley ha ha!", c.returnData() );
z = fork( function( a ) {
+ load('jstests/libs/parallelTester.js');
var y = fork( function( a ) {
return a + 1; }, 5 );
y.start();